Study at Beaufort County Community College


Beaufort County Community College, also referred to as BCCC, is a coeducational, public, community college located in Washington, North Carolina, United States. The institution offers a host of associate degrees, diploma programs, certificate programs, and developmental education programs in the fields of allied health, business, industrial technology, etc.

Beaufort County Community College offers the following academic divisions:

  • Allied Health
  • Arts and Sciences and College Transfer
  • Business
  • Industrial Technology
The campus of Beaufort County Community College is home to a large number of student clubs and organizations, including HOPE Club, Les Kosmetiques, MLT Club and Beaufort County Association of Nursing Students (BCANS).

Profile of Beaufort County Community College

The campus of Beaufort County Community College is in Washington, NC, which is a town not particularly near any major cities. The school is a public institution. Degrees at Beaufort County Community College include, at the school's highest level, the Associate's degree.

Course Topics

The school has a greater breadth of degree programs (majors) than most colleges of its size. Beaufort County Community College is known for its programs in landscaping and horticulture, engineering technician, and production trades.

Beaufort County Community College Selectivity

Its open admissions system makes the school an attractive choice for many applicants.

Faculty

Beaufort County Community College maintains a faculty/student ratio (full-time) which is better than most colleges.

Student Enrolment

In 2007, the school had 1, 476 students enrolled (888 full-time equivalent).
